How Natural Foods Can Help You Feel Fuller for Longer

Natural foods, especially those rich in fiber, healthy fats, and protein, can help you stay full longer without relying on overly processed options.

Choose High-Fiber Foods

Fiber slows digestion and supports steady energy levels.

Natural sources of fiber include:

  • Oats – Great for breakfast or snacks
  • Vegetables – Leafy greens, broccoli, carrots, and sweet potatoes
  • Legumes – Lentils, chickpeas, and black beans

Including these in your meals can help you feel full for hours.

Add Healthy Fats

Not all fats are the same. Healthy fats can support fullness and improve the flavor of your food. Some natural options are:

  • Avocados
  • Nuts and seeds (like almonds, chia, or flaxseeds)
  • Olive oil

A little goes a long way. Add them to salads, smoothies, or whole-grain toast.

Focus on Protein

Protein-rich foods are essential for lasting satisfaction. Natural protein sources include:

  • Eggs
  • Greek yogurt
  • Tofu and tempeh
  • Fish or lean meats

Mixing protein with fiber at each meal helps balance your hunger levels.

Drink Enough Water

Sometimes, thirst feels like hunger. Drinking water throughout the day—and with meals—can help you recognize real hunger signals and support digestion.

Choose Whole Grains

Unlike refined grains, whole grains take longer to break down, keeping you full longer. Try:

  • Brown rice
  • Quinoa
  • Whole-grain bread or pasta

These pair well with vegetables and lean proteins for a satisfying meal.

Snack Smarter

Instead of processed snacks, reach for natural options like:

  • Apple slices with peanut butter
  • Carrot sticks and hummus
  • A handful of trail mix

Balanced snacks can help bridge the gap between meals without a spike in hunger.
